Diagnostic Evaluation
We carry out full diagnostics, including flow gain, leakage, pressure shift, and frequency testing, on every valve. Our test facility supports detailed performance logging and report generation for quality assurance. Our pre-shipment testing ensures consistent performance.

Repair Process
The process begins with disassembly and visual evaluation. We then clean, replace worn pieces, and reassemble the valve with care to restore its function.
- Rigorous Testing: The reassembled unit undergoes rigorous leak and pressure testing to verify it performs to specification.
- Meticulous Cleaning: All parts undergo an ultrasonic cleaning process to remove contaminants before inspection.
- Comprehensive Teardown: Every valve is fully disassembled for a thorough internal inspection.
- In-House Parts Sourcing: Many repairs use reliable components sourced from our extensive inventory of existing units.
Maintenance Tips
- Replace inline filters according to maintenance schedules to maintain proper flow rates.
- Check valve alignment carefully to prevent undue stress on internal components.
- Conduct visual inspections for wear or leaks.
